Bert Carter was born in 1896 in Celeste, Hunt County, Texas, United States of America, the child of James Monroe Carter And Lyda Lou Carter. In 1939, Bert Carter resided in Terrell, Kaufman, Texas, USA. Bert Carter married Lillie Newman, Mabel C Bell Guy, and had children including Bert Lindell Carter, Ester Carter, Ruth Ann Carter. Bert Carter passed away in 1951 in Terrell, Kaufman County, Texas, United States of America.
